I didn't know whether Matt was ready or not, but I felt it couldn't hurt for him to get in a little AAA ball, since he hadn't played at that level. Matt was definitely a surprise to me.
I think Matt reinforces a couple of points:
First, even though baseball positions each have their "role" at the plate and the hot corner is considered a power position, the thing is to put the best players on the field, regardless of their characteristics at the plate.
Second, as we have entered into more of a pitching era over the past decade, these "roles" have become even more blurred.
Matt is one of the reasons we are more aware of this than we were as a group a year ago. I know I have learned a lot in that regard. The 2015 Giants team that some feared wouldn't reach even triple digits in home runs got to 131 and finished 5th in the league in scoring.
